High Demand for Blue-Collar Workers

New Zealand is currently experiencing a shortage of skilled workers in a number of industries. This includes tradespeople such as carpenters, electricians, and plumbers, as well as those in manufacturing, construction, and agriculture. This means that there are many job opportunities available for skilled blue-collar workers.

In addition, New Zealand has a point-based immigration system that prioritizes skilled workers. This means that if you have the skills and experience needed for one of the in-demand occupations, you may be able to immigrate to New Zealand more easily.

Fair Wages and Working Conditions

New Zealand has a minimum wage that is set at a living wage level, which means that even entry-level workers can earn a decent wage. In addition, the country has strict labor laws that protect workers' rights and ensure fair working conditions. This means that blue-collar workers in New Zealand can expect to be paid fairly and to work in safe, healthy environments.

If you are interested in immigrating to New Zealand, there are a few things you should know before you begin the process. First, you will need to assess your eligibility for a visa based on your skills and work experience. You can do this through the New Zealand government's official immigration website.

Once you have determined your eligibility, you will need to submit an application for a visa and provide evidence of your skills and qualifications. You may also need to undergo a medical examination and provide police clearance certificates.
